PINS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

846 of the 7,619 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pinterest (PINS)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$18B — down 8.7% from $19.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 135 funds opened new PINS positions and 131 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 331 added to existing stakes and 254 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Davis Selected Advisers, opening a new position worth an estimated $286M. The largest seller was Point72 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$211M sold.
